Section 1474 - Standardized Procedure Guidelines
Universal Citation: 16 CA Code of Regs 1474
Current through Register 2024 Notice Reg. No. 12, March 22, 2024
Following are the standardized procedure guidelines jointly promulgated by the Medical Board of California and by the Board of Registered Nursing:
(a) Standardized procedures shall include a written description of the method used in developing and approving them and any revision thereof.
(b) Each standardized procedure shall:
(1) Be in writing, dated and signed by the
organized health care system personnel authorized to approve it.
(2) Specify which standardized procedure
functions registered nurses may perform and under what circumstances.
(3) State any specific requirements which are
to be followed by registered nurses in performing particular standardized
procedure functions.
(4) Specify
any experience, training, and/or education requirements for performance of
standardized procedure functions.
(5) Establish a method for initial and
continuing evaluation of the competence of those registered nurses authorized
to perform standardized procedure functions.
(6) Provide for a method of maintaining a
written record of those persons authorized to perform standardized procedure
functions.
(7) Specify the scope of
supervision required for performance of standardized procedure functions, for
example, immediate supervision by a physician.
(8) Set forth any specialized circumstances
under which the registered nurse is to immediately communicate with a patient's
physician concerning the patient's condition.
(9) State the limitations on settings, if
any, in which standardized procedure functions may be performed.
(10) Specify patient record keeping
requirements.
(11) Provide for a
method of periodic review of the standardized procedures.
1. Amendment of first paragraph and new NOTE filed 2-1-96; operative 3-2-96 (Register 96, No. 5).
Note: Authority cited: Section 2715, Business and Professions Code. Reference: Section 2725, Business and Professions Code.
